#f4d6e4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f4d6e4 is composed of 95.7% red, 83.9% green and 89.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 12.3% magenta, 6.6%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 332 degrees, a saturation of 57.7% and a lightness of 89.8%. #f4d6e4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#e9adc9. Closest websafe color is: #ffcccc.

Shades and Tints of #f4d6e4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050103 is the darkest color, while #fcf5f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#f4d6e4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#e6e4e5 is the less saturated color, while #fecce3 is the most saturated one.
